Transaction 39c95f217284eb2f75665ed0ae18c9437311648a8b78bfad91ce74a7965acdeb
1 Input
1 Output
-
39c95f217284eb2f75665ed0ae18c9437311648a8b78bfad91ce74a7965acdeb:0
- value
- 43945
- script pubkey
- OP_0 OP_PUSHBYTES_20 35cc393f357776b282a0ab2677d0af298769f722
- address
- bc1qxhxrj0e4wamt9q4q4vn805909xrknaezzeu6r9